Output fa31339821f01f9a5ad565a184b35a4e0a5ce4b2368598951c544ffaaeb6fdfd:1

value
17549612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e7ebf9ce333cd2cba1d6073f5c1340d3a04320 OP_EQUAL
address
3DXtvVpUJCF436mAuXHgryAK8FGdZ7sbRR
transaction
fa31339821f01f9a5ad565a184b35a4e0a5ce4b2368598951c544ffaaeb6fdfd
spent
true